The Churchill Stonecast Patina range sits within Churchill's broader reactive-glaze tableware collection, and these 153mm triangular bowls are a well-considered choice for operators who want serviceware that contributes to plate presentation without overpowering the food. The distinctive black finish carries subtle tonal variation across each piece — a deliberate result of the hand-finished glaze process — so no two bowls are identical, giving front-of-house a considered, crafted aesthetic at a commercial price point.
In day-to-day service these bowls are practical to work with. The triangular form suits small portions: amuse-bouche, pre-desserts, single-ingredient starters, or shared side dishes. At 153mm across they are modest in footprint, which suits tighter table layouts and reduces the counter space needed for stacking during prep and service.
Being vitrified ceramic, these bowls are built to withstand the demands of a busy restaurant environment rather than occasional domestic use. Key practical points include:
- Vitrified ceramic construction for durability under regular commercial use
- Suitable for commercial dishwashers, reducing manual handling time
- Hand-finished reactive glaze gives natural variation across each piece
- Compact 153mm size works well for starter and dessert courses
- Sold in packs of 12, supporting practical stock rotation
There are no unusual handling requirements — these stack cleanly, resist chipping better than standard earthenware, and the black glaze tends to show water marks less prominently than lighter finishes, which is worth noting for front-of-house presentation between services.
These bowls suit restaurants, bistros, and hotels where visual presentation is a priority and serviceware sees daily machine washing. - Yes — the vitrified ceramic construction is designed to withstand repeated commercial dishwasher cycles. Vitrified ceramic is considerably more durable than standard earthenware and maintains its glaze integrity under regular high-temperature machine washing, which is important in kitchens running multiple services daily.
- That depends on your service pattern and how frequently bowls are washed during a sitting. For a 40-cover operation using these as a starter or dessert bowl, two packs of 12 — giving 24 pieces — is typically a working minimum, though most operators prefer a buffer of around 30–40% above cover count to allow for breakages and mid-service washing.
